Full Job Description
Were looking for a highly motivated, creative candidate with strong experience in new product introductions at scale to join the EDA Team. Principal Software Engineer available for suitable candidates. You will lead the architecture, design and implementation of our EDA clusters using the latest technologies. Are you ready to change the next generation of computing? Join us at the forefront of technological advancement.

What youll be doing:
  • Lead technical activities for new product introductions at scale with focus on hybrid deployments between cloud and on-prem
  • Providing expertise in new product introduction planning spanning infrastructure workflows, hardware, software release, workload orchestration and application tuning
  • Provide fast and creative solutions for complex problems and write effective, clear and reliable architecture specification
  • Translate requirements to vision, architecture and roadmap
  • Work with engineering teams across NVIDIA to ensure new product architectures integrate seamlessly from the hardware all the way up to workloads.


What we need to see:
  • 12+ overall years of experience
  • BS degree in Computer Science or a related technical field involving coding (e.g., physics or mathematics) or equivalent experience.
  • A proven track record of impactful project deliveries focused on cloud infrastructure or cloud application services.
  • Experience with at scale infrastructure, DevOps and/or SRE practices and/or Platform Engineering.
  • Systematic problem-solving approach, coupled with strong communications skills and a sense of ownership and drive.
  • System-level experience with both hardware and software
  • Motivated self-starter with an equal balance of strong problem-solving skills and customer-facing communication skills
  • Passion for continuous learning and knowledge transfer. Ability to work concurrently with multiple groups locally and abroad in the organization


Ways to stand out from the crowd:
  • Developing ML/AI infrastructure. Developing bare metal as a service (BMaaS) associated systems. Developing multi-cloud infrastructure services.
  • Interest in crafting, analyzing and fixing large-scale distributed systems.
  • Systematic problem-solving approach, coupled with strong communication skills and a sense of ownership and drive.


Your base salary will be determined based on your location, experience, and the pay of employees in similar positions. The base salary range is 224,000 USD - 356,500 USD for Level 5, and 272,000 USD - 431,250 USD for Level 6.
